<?php
namespace browserfs\website;
/**
* The browserfs\website\Cache implements a generic cache driver. All cache driver
* implementations should extend this class.
*/
abstract class Cache extends \browserfs\EventEmitter
{
/**
* @var string -> the cache source name
*/
protected $name = null;
/**
* @var string -> a prefix used by the 'get' and the 'set' methods
*/
protected $namespaces = [];
/**
* @var string[] -> a mapping between each cache scheme name,
* and it's implementing full qualified namespace classes.
*/
private static $factories = [];
/**
* Creates a new cache instance. Protected, do not use the constructor,
* use the "factory" method instead.
* @param $config -> [ "host"?: <string>, "port"?: <int>, "user"?: <string>, "pass"?: <string>, "path"?: <string>, "query"?: <string> ]
* @param string $cacheSourceName - the name of the cache.
*/
protected function __construct( $config, $cacheSourceName ) {
if ( !is_string( $cacheSourceName ) || strlen( $cacheSourceName ) === 0 ) {
throw new \browserfs\Exception('Invalid argument $cacheSourceName: Expected non-empty string' );
}
$this->name = $cacheSourceName;
}
/**
* Returns the value of a property called "$key" from the cache.
* @param string $key - the name of the property to be retrieved.
*/
abstract public function get( $key );
/**
* Sets the value of a property called "$key" in the cache.
* @param string $key - the name of the property to be set
* @param string $value - the serialized value of the property.
* A cache driver implementation should check if the value
* is of type string, or throw an exception.
* @param int $timeToLive - the time ( expressed in seconds ) that the
* cache is valid. After this time, the cache expires.
* -1 - the cache will never expire. For cache engines which are not persistent,
* this is equal with the "0" value.
* 0 - the cache will expire upon script termination
* >0 - the cache will expire in $timeToLive seconds
*
*/
abstract public function set( $key, $value, $timeToLive );
/**
* Eliminates from the cache store the property with the name
* called $key
* @param string $key - the name of the property which will be eliminated.
*/
abstract public function delete( $key );
/**
* Resets the cache (delete all it's properties)
*/
abstract public function clear();
/**
* Creates a Cache namespace warpper. A Cache namespace wrapper
* @param string $nsName
* @return \browserfs\website\Cache
*/
public function createNamespace( $nsName ) {
if ( !is_string( $nsName ) || !$nsName === '' ) {
throw new \browserfs\Exception('Invalid argument $nsName: Expected non-empty string' );
}
return isset( $this->namespaces[ $nsName ] )
? $this->namespaces[ $nsName ]
: $this->namespaces[ $nsName ] = \browserfs\website\Cache\NamespaceWrapper::create( $this, $nsName );
}
/**
* Returns the name of the cache object
* @return string
*/
public function getName()
{
return $this->name;
}
/**
* Returns TRUE if the cache engine has a registered driver implementation for a
* specific URL scheme name, and false otherwise.
* @param string $cacheSchemeName - the name of the scheme ( lowercased )
* @return boolean
*/
public static function supportsDriverType( $cacheSchemeName )
{
return is_string( $cacheSchemeName )
? isset( self::$factories[ $cacheSchemeName ] )
: false;
}
/**
* Registers a cache driver for a specific scheme name.
* @param string $cacheSchemeName: the scheme ( e.g: "memcache", "apc", "memory", etc. )
* @param string $implementingClassWithFullNamespace - the name of the class that is
* implementing this cache driver. The class must extend \browserfs\website\Cache
* class ( this class ).
* @return void
* @throws \browserfs\Exception on invalid arguments
*/
public static function registerDriver( $cacheSchemeName, $implementingClassWithFullNamespace )
{
if ( !is_string( $cacheSchemeName ) || $cacheSchemeName === '' ) {
throw new \browserfs\Exception('Invalid argument $cacheSchemeName: Expected non-empty string');
}
if ( !is_string( $implementingClassWithFullNamespace ) || $implementingClassWithFullNamespace === '' ) {
throw new \browserfs\Exception('Invalid argument $implementingClassWithFullNamespace: Expecting non-empty string' );
}
if ( isset( self::$factories[ $cacheSchemeName ] ) ) {
throw new \browserfs\Exception('A driver implementing "' . $cacheSchemeName . '" cache is allready registered!' );
}
self::$factories[ $cacheSchemeName ] = $implementingClassWithFullNamespace;
}
/**
* Static factory constructor. Use this constructor instead of the "new ..." syntax.
*/
public static function factory( $cacheTypeSchemaName, $cacheDriverConnectionConfig, $cacheSourceName )
{
if ( !is_string( $cacheTypeSchemaName ) || $cacheTypeSchemaName === '' ) {
throw new \browserfs\Exception('Invalid argument $cacheTypeSchemaName: non-empty string expected!');
}
if ( !is_array( $cacheDriverConnectionConfig ) ) {
throw new \browserfs\Exception('Invalid argument $cacheDriverConnectionConfig: array expected!' );
}
if ( !is_string( $cacheSourceName ) || $cacheSourceName === '' ) {
throw new \browserfs\Exception('Invalid argument $cacheSourceName: Expected non-empty string!' );
}
if ( !isset( self::$factories[ $cacheTypeSchemaName ] ) ) {
throw new \browserfs\Exception('Failed to instantiate cache of type "' . $cacheTypeSchemaName . '": No driver provider registered!' );
}
try {
$className = self::$factories[ $cacheTypeSchemaName ];
if ( !class_exists( $className ) ) {
throw new \browserfs\Exception('Class "' . $className . '" implementing cache of type "' . $cacheTypeSchemaName . '" was not found!' );
}
$result = new $className( $cacheDriverConnectionConfig, $cacheSourceName );
if ( !( $result instanceof \browserfs\website\Cache ) ) {
throw new \browserfs\Exception('Although a declared cache driver for scheme "' . $cacheTypeSchemaName . '" was found in class "' . $className . '", it could not be used because it does not extend \\browserfs\\website\\Cache');
}
return $result;
} catch ( \Exception $e ) {
throw new \browserfs\Exception('Failed to initialize cache source "' . $cacheSourceName . '": ' . $e->getMessage(), 1, $e );
}
}
}
\browserfs\website\Cache::registerDriver('memory', '\\' . __NAMESPACE__ . '\\Cache\\Driver\\Memory' );
